{"id":86,"date":"2025-04-03T07:26:01","date_gmt":"2025-04-03T07:26:01","guid":{"rendered":"https:\/\/documentation.iqonic.design\/streamit-laravel\/?p=86"},"modified":"2026-01-29T10:22:56","modified_gmt":"2026-01-29T10:22:56","slug":"ios-configuration","status":"publish","type":"post","link":"https:\/\/documentation.iqonic.design\/streamit-laravel\/ios-configuration\/","title":{"rendered":"iOS Configuration"},"content":{"rendered":"<div class=\"nolwrap\">\n<p>\ud83d\udd52\u00a0<strong>Estimated Reading Time<\/strong>: 2 minutes<\/p>\n\n\n\n<p>Setting up iOS for your Streamit Laravel Projec<\/p>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Open Project in Xcode<a href=\"https:\/\/apps.iqonic.design\/documentation\/streamit-laravel-documentation\/build\/docs\/getting-started\/app\/configuration\/ios#open-project-in-xcode\" target=\"_blank\" rel=\"noopener\">\u200b<\/a><\/strong><\/h2>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Open xcode.<\/li>\n\n\n\n<li>Select open another project.<\/li>\n\n\n\n<li>Open the ios directory within your app.<\/li>\n\n\n\n<li>Now, click on done button.<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Change Bundle Name<\/strong><\/h2>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Select your project file icon in group and files panel.<\/li>\n\n\n\n<li>Then select&nbsp;<strong>target \u2192 info tab.<\/strong><\/li>\n\n\n\n<li>At last change bundle name. By following these steps, you can change the bundle name for your ios target in xcode.<\/li>\n<\/ol>\n\n\n\n<figure class=\"wp-block-image size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"1440\" height=\"836\" src=\"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-content\/uploads\/sites\/5\/2025\/04\/iOS_Configuration1.png\" alt=\"\" class=\"wp-image-394\" \/><\/figure>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Change Bundle Identifier<\/strong><\/h2>\n\n\n\n<p>Bundle Id is a unique Identifier of your of app on iOS and MacOS. iOS and MacOS use it to recognise updates to your app. The identifier must be unique for your app.<\/p>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Select your project file icon in group and files panel.<\/li>\n\n\n\n<li>Select general tab.<\/li>\n\n\n\n<li>After select general tab you can see the details of your application.<\/li>\n\n\n\n<li>In identity section, rename your Bundle identifier.<\/li>\n<\/ol>\n\n\n\n<figure class=\"wp-block-image size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"1439\" height=\"832\" src=\"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-content\/uploads\/sites\/5\/2025\/04\/iOS_Configuration2.png\" alt=\"\" class=\"wp-image-395\" \/><\/figure>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Change App Icons<\/strong><\/h2>\n\n\n\n<ol class=\"wp-block-list\">\n<li>see&nbsp;<a href=\"https:\/\/makeappicon.com\/\" target=\"_blank\" rel=\"noreferrer noopener\">How to Generate App Icons?<\/a><\/li>\n\n\n\n<li>In group and files panel find \u201cAssets.xcassets\u201d folder.<\/li>\n\n\n\n<li>In Assets.xcassets folder replace appicon.<\/li>\n<\/ol>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Change the Google AdMob App ID Info.plist<\/strong><\/h2>\n\n\n\n<pre class=\"wp-block-preformatted\">&lt;key&gt;GADApplicationIdentifier&lt;\/key&gt;<br>&lt;string&gt;GOOGLE_ADMOB_APP_ID&lt;\/string&gt;<\/pre>\n\n\n\n<h2 class=\"wp-block-heading\"><strong>Configuration iOS Notification<\/strong><\/h2>\n\n\n\n<ol class=\"wp-block-list\">\n<li>Enable Firebase Notification in Mobile for both&nbsp;<a href=\"https:\/\/documentation.iqonic.design\/streamit-laravel\/configurations-customization\/firebase-configuration\">click hear<\/a><\/li>\n<\/ol>\n\n\n\n<ul class=\"wp-block-list\">\n<li>Add the below code in appdelegate.swift file under ios folder in your project:<\/li>\n<\/ul>\n\n\n\n<figure class=\"wp-block-image size-full\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"396\" src=\"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-content\/uploads\/sites\/5\/2025\/04\/iOS_Configuration3.png\" alt=\"\" class=\"wp-image-396\" \/><\/figure>\n\n\n\n<pre class=\"wp-block-preformatted\">if #available(iOS 10.0, *) {<br>  UNUserNotificationCenter.current().delegate<br>  = self as? UNUserNotificationCenterDelegate<br>}<\/pre>\n\n\n\n<p><\/p>\n<\/div>","protected":false},"excerpt":{"rendered":"<p>\ud83d\udd52\u00a0Estimated Reading Time: 2 minutes Setting up iOS for your Streamit Laravel Projec Open Project in Xcode\u200b Change Bundle Name Change Bundle Identifier Bundle Id is a unique Identifier of your of app on iOS and MacOS. iOS and MacOS use it to recognise updates to your app. The identifier must be unique for your [&hellip;]<\/p>\n","protected":false},"author":11,"featured_media":0,"parent":78,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1],"tags":[],"class_list":["post-86","post","type-post","status-publish","format-standard","hentry","category-uncategorized"],"featured_image_src":null,"author_info":{"display_name":"laraveladminiq","author_link":"https:\/\/documentation.iqonic.design\/streamit-laravel\/author\/laraveladminiq\/"},"children":[],"_links":{"self":[{"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/posts\/86","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/users\/11"}],"replies":[{"embeddable":true,"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/comments?post=86"}],"version-history":[{"count":6,"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/posts\/86\/revisions"}],"predecessor-version":[{"id":1714,"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/posts\/86\/revisions\/1714"}],"up":[{"embeddable":true,"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/posts\/78"}],"wp:attachment":[{"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/media?parent=86"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/categories?post=86"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/documentation.iqonic.design\/streamit-laravel\/wp-json\/wp\/v2\/tags?post=86"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}